Output 3663093c3e419da9e1ae0257e7478d7a41a4d22e745c6f9c2c377a77edec2923:4

value
133803692
script pubkey
OP_0 OP_PUSHBYTES_20 ddf8ad8ba1285b0cb8b0535ce43e3ce301b18dc8
address
ltc1qmhu2mzap9pdsew9s2dwwg03uuvqmrrwgpv2mu2
transaction
3663093c3e419da9e1ae0257e7478d7a41a4d22e745c6f9c2c377a77edec2923
spent
true